How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• holding that agency abused its discretion in failing to consider applicability of regulation to case
  • deciding whether the administrative agency failed to follow its own regulations, even though this claim had not been briefed on appeal, when the issue had been briefed in the superior court, and when this issue was “potentially determinative” of the case
